Development of gross domestic product in billions of USD 1984 - 2024

Year GDP (billions USD) GDP per capita (USD)
2024 16.50 2,124
2023 15.84 2,067
2022 15.47 2,046
2021 18.83 2,526
2020 18.98 2,584
2019 18.74 2,589
2018 18.14 2,545
2017 17.07 2,432
2016 15.91 2,303
2015 14.43 2,121
2014 13.28 1,981
2013 11.98 1,813
2012 10.19 1,564
2011 8.75 1,362
2010 7.13 1,126
2009 5.84 935
2008 5.45 886
2007 4.22 697
2006 3.46 579
2005 2.74 466
2004 2.37 409
2003 2.02 355
2002 1.76 313
2001 1.77 320
2000 1.73 319
1999 1.45 272
1998 1.28 244
1997 1.75 339
1996 1.87 371
1995 1.76 358
1994 1.54 321
1993 1.33 283
1992 1.13 247
1991 1.03 232
1990 0.87 201
1989 0.71 170
1988 0.60 147
1987 1.09 275
1986 1.78 462
1985 2.37 633
1984 1.76 483

Unemployment rates in percentages 1991 - 2025

The unemployment rate is calculated as the percentage of unemployed persons in the total labor force. Data source: ILOSTAT

Year Unemployment Rate (%)
2025 1.2%
2024 1.2%
2023 1.2%
2022 1.2%
2021 2.1%
2020 2.3%
2019 2.5%
2018 2.9%
2017 3.3%
2016 2.6%
2015 2.0%
2014 1.7%
2013 1.5%
2012 1.2%
2011 1.0%
2010 0.7%
2009 0.8%
2008 0.9%
2007 1.1%
2006 1.2%
2005 1.4%
2004 1.5%
2003 1.6%
2002 1.8%
2001 1.9%
2000 2.0%
1999 2.2%
1998 2.3%
1997 2.4%
1996 2.5%
1995 2.6%
1994 2.6%
1993 2.7%
1992 2.7%
1991 2.5%

Inflation rates in percentages 1989 - 2024

Year Inflation Rate (%)
2024 23.1%
2023 31.2%
2022 23.0%
2021 3.8%
2020 5.1%
2019 3.3%
2018 2.0%
2017 0.8%
2016 1.6%
2015 1.3%
2014 4.1%
2013 6.4%
2012 4.3%
2011 7.6%
2010 6.0%
2009 0.1%
2008 7.6%
2007 4.7%
2006 6.5%
2005 7.2%
2004 10.5%
2003 15.5%
2002 10.6%
2001 7.8%
2000 25.1%
1999 125.3%
1998 91.0%
1997 27.5%
1996 13.0%
1995 19.6%
1994 6.8%
1993 6.3%
1992 9.9%
1991 13.4%
1990 35.6%
1989 61.3%
